Congratulations on your purchase of the ZyXEL ZyAIR B-4000 Hot Spot Gateway.

The ZyAIR Hot Spot Gateway combines an 802.11b wireless access point, router, 4-port switch and service
gateway in one box. An “exclusive printer” connects directly to the ZyAIR, allowing you to easily print
subscriber statements. The ZyAIR is ideal for offices, coffee shops, libraries, hotels and airport terminals
catering to subscribers that seek Internet access. You should have an Internet account already set up and
have been given usernames, passwords etc. required for Internet access.

This user’s guide is designed to guide you through the configuration of your ZyAIR using the web
configurator.

Syntax Conventions

• “Enter” means for you to type one or more characters (and press the carriage return). “Select” or

“Choose” means for you to use one of the predefined choices.

• Mouse action sequences are denoted using a comma. For example, “click the Apple icon, Control

Panels and then Modem” means first click the Apple icon, then point your mouse pointer to Control
Panels
and then click Modem.
